A solar street light typically consumes between 10 to 80 watts, depending on its use case. wattage affects brightness and efficiency, 3. specific requirements depend on environmental conditions and local. . For efficient operation, solar street lights require a balanced combination of LED wattage, battery storage, and panel wattage. But when it comes to highways or industrial zones, you're likely looking at 60 watts or more. High-lumen LED chips, monocrystalline solar panels, MPPT charge controllers, and durable materials ensure long-lasting performance. Specifically, the power of solar street lights of different models and specifications varies: 5W to 120W: This is the common power range of solar street lights, suitable for different lighting needs and. . The ideal solar streetlight power depends on location, lighting goals, and overall budget.
